Details
A vulnerability classified as problematic has been found in Samsung Escargot 97e8115ab1110bc502b4b5e4a0c689a71520d335. This affects an unknown functionality. The manipulation with an unknown input leads to a deserialization vulnerability. CWE is classifying the issue as CWE-502. The product deserializes untrusted data without sufficiently verifying that the resulting data will be valid. This is going to have an impact on availability. The summary by CVE is:
Deserialization of untrusted data vulnerability in Samsung Open Source Escarogt Java Script allows denial of service condition via process abort. This issue affects escarogt prior to commit hash 97e8115ab1110bc502b4b5e4a0c689a71520d335
The advisory is shared at github.com. This vulnerability is uniquely identified as CVE-2026-25204 since 01/30/2026. The exploitability is told to be easy. An attack has to be approached locally. Neither technical details nor an exploit are publicly available.
Applying a patch is able to eliminate this problem. The bugfix is ready for download at github.com.
